Recall 203558

  • USA Recall: An incorrectly wired oil pressure sensor will not alert the driver to low oil pressure, possibly resulting in an engine stall and increasing the risk of a crash.
    Isuzu technical center of america, inc. (isuzu) is recalling certain 2022 nqr gas and nrr gas trucks equipped with 6.0l engines. the engine wiring harness assembly was incorrectly wired to the oil pressure sensor.

    Corrective Action:
    Dealers will fix the engine wiring harness assembly connector in the engine oil pressure sensor, free of charge.. owner notification letters were mailed on july 29, 2022. owners may contact isuzu's customer service at 1-866-441-9638. isuzu's number for this recall is v2202.
